I would start with the BIGGEST injectors you can get your hands on... . maybe a p7100 fuel pump thats been worked over by Piers. Then and a turbo combination to enhance the air requirements. A ported head will help with flow into and out of the combustion chamber. Of course the drivetrain will need a little massaging to take the new increase in power.
